  • Schedule 13G & 13D forms are used to report a party's ownership of stock which exceeds 5% of a company's total stock issue.
  • Schedule 13G is a shorter version of Schedule 13D with fewer reporting requirements.

Item 1. Security and Issuer.
   

This joint statement on Schedule 13D (this “Schedule 13D”) is filed with respect to the common shares, par value $0.01 per share (the “Common Shares”), of Performance Shipping Inc., a corporation formed under the laws of the Republic of the Marshall Islands (the “Issuer”) and having its principal executive offices at 373 Syngrou Avenue, 175 64 Palaio Faliro, Athens, Greece.

 

Item 2. Identity and Background.

 

(a), (f) This Schedule 13D is being filed by Sphinx Investment Corp., a corporation organized under the laws of the Republic of the Marshall Islands. (“Sphinx”), Mayport Navigation Corp., a corporation organized under the laws of the Republic of Liberia (“Maryport”) and George Economou, a Greek citizen (“Mr. Economou”, and collectively with Sphinx and Maryport, the “Reporting Persons”). Sphinx and Maryport are both controlled by Mr. Economou.

 

The sole director and executive officer of each of Sphinx and Maryport is Levante Services Limited (“Levante”), a corporation organized under the laws of the Republic of Liberia.1

 

(b) The address of the principal office of Sphinx and Maryport is c/o Levante Services Limited, Leoforos Evagorou 31, 2nd Floor, Office 21 1066 Nicosia Cyprus. The business address of Mr. Economou is c/o Levante Services Limited, Leoforos Evagorou 31, 2nd Floor, Office 21 1066 Nicosia, Cyprus. The address of the principal office of Levante is Leoforos Evagorou 31, 2nd Floor, Office 21 1066 Nicosia, Cyprus.

 

(c) The principal business of each of Sphinx and Maryport is the making of investments in securities. The principal occupation of Mr. Economou is investor and business executive, and such business is conducted through, among other entities, Sphinx and Maryport. The principal business of Levante is acting as director, president, treasurer and secretary of Sphinx, Maryport and other companies.

Item 3. Source and Amount of Funds or Other Consideration.

 

Sphinx purchased the 1,033,859 Common Shares reported herein for a total purchase price of $1,483,268, including fees and expenses. The source of funds used by Sphinx to purchase the Common Shares is its working capital. Unless noted above, no part of the purchase price for such Common Shares was borrowed by any Reporting Person for the purpose of acquiring, holding, trading or voting any securities discussed in this Item 3.

 

Item 4. Purpose of Transaction.

 

The responses to Item 3 of this Schedule 13D is incorporated herein by reference.

 

The Reporting Persons acquired the Common Shares over which they exercise beneficial ownership in the belief that the Common Shares are undervalued and are an attractive investment. The Reporting Persons from time to time expect to enter into discussions with directors and officers of the Issuer, other stockholders of the Issuer or third parties in connection with the Reporting Persons’ investment in the Issuer. Such discussions may include, without limitation, one or more of members of management, members of the board (individually or acting as a whole), other stockholders of the Issuer and other persons to discuss the governance, board composition, management, operations, business, assets, capitalization, financial condition, strategic plans and future of the Issuer, as well as other matters related to the Issuer. These discussions may review options for enhancing stockholder value through, among other things, various strategic alternatives, including without limitation asset dispositions, or operational or management initiatives. The Reporting Persons may also seek to explore increasing their ownership position in the Issuer, including, without limitation, through open market purchases or an acquisition of Common Shares from other stockholders.

 

The Reporting Persons intend to review their respective investments in the Issuer on a continuing basis and may from time to time and at any time in the future depending on various factors, including, without limitation, the outcome of any discussions referenced above, the Issuer’s financial position and strategic direction, actions taken by the board, price levels of the Common Shares, other investment opportunities available to the Reporting Persons, concentrations in the portfolios managed by the Reporting Persons, conditions in the securities, shipping and other markets and general economic and industry conditions, take such actions with respect to the investment in the Issuer as they deem appropriate, including, without limitation: (i) acquiring additional Common Shares and/or other equity, debt, notes, other securities, or derivative or other instruments that are based upon or relate to the value of the Common Shares or otherwise relate to the Issuer (collectively, “Securities”) in the open market or otherwise; (ii) disposing of any or all of their Securities in the open market or otherwise; (iii) engaging in any hedging or similar transactions with respect to the Securities; or (iv) proposing or considering, or changing their intention with respect to, one or more of the actions described in subsections (a) through (j) of Item 4 of Schedule 13D.

Item 5. Interest in Securities of the Issuer.

 

(a), (b) The Reporting Persons each may be deemed to beneficially own all of the 1,033,859 Common Shares (the “Subject Shares”) reported herein, which represent approximately 9.5% of Issuer’s outstanding Common Shares, based on the 10,910,319 Common Shares stated by Issuer as being outstanding as of August 18, 2023 in the Issuer’s August 2023 6-K.
